4-H SPARK Clubs are here

Are you looking for a creative outlet this winter? 4-H SPARK clubs are a way to get a sample of the 4-H experience in a short amount of time. Two 4-H SPARK Clubs are all ready for youth in grades 3-12: Creative Paper Crafting and Leather Craft.  Creative Paper Crafting includes Iris Folding (Feb. 4), Paper Flowers (March 4), and Quilling (April 8). Leather Craft will be a one-day workshop on Feb. 11. Both programs take place at the Hamilton County 4-H Fairgrounds and require pre-registration by Feb. 1, 2017. A $25 annual 4-H program fee plus supply fee is due at time of registration. Youth already enrolled in 4-H will only pay the supply fee.
